WebSite X5Help Center

 
Rino D.
Rino D.
User

Webanimator attivare l'animazione solo quando visibile  it

Autore: Rino D.
Visite 331, Followers 1, Condiviso 0  

Salve
Ho inserito un animazione fatta con webanimator in un cella che si trova a fondo pagina ,
naturalmente l 'animazione parte subito come viene caricata la pagine c'e' un modo in webanimator
per dirgli di farla partire solo quando l ' utente ha ragiunto il livello di visibilità della cella giusto?
Saluti

Postato il
8 RISPOSTE - 3 UTILI - 1 CORRETTO
Rino D.
Rino D.
User
Autore

Se posso assegnare un id al progetto
magari posso usare jquery ho trovato on-line
qualche dritta tipo
Jquery.scrolling: controllare la comparsa e la scomparsa degli elementi nel Viewport
ma magari c'è già presente qualche metodo in webanimator che non conosco e
che mi facilita la vita..... c'è qualcuno che ha familiarità con il  programma? 

Leggi di più
Postato il da Rino D.
Claudio D.
Claudio D.
Moderator
Utente del mese IT

per webanimator chiedi direttamente sul loro forum ...

http://forum.webanimator.com/

per il lazy loading , non ho mai provato ma con qualche jquery potrebbe funzionare...

Leggi di più
Postato il da Claudio D.
 ‪ KolAsim ‪ ‪
 ‪ KolAsim ‪ ‪
Moderator

... come già anticipato da Claudio, forse! il ▪Lazy Loading  potrebbe fare al caso; ...non adatto però a tutti gli oggetti...

... se si è esperti, si possono attingere idee anche a partire da >> qua   ...

... come mia IDEA, sempre se sì è esperti, si potrebbe programmare un controllo JS, che riavvii l'animazione importandola in IFRAME nel momento che l'oggetto sia all'interno della finestra...

... con rimpianto posso solo dire che con SwishMax sarebbe stato semplicissimo da ottenere...

.



Leggi di più
Postato il da  ‪ KolAsim ‪ ‪
Rino D.
Rino D.
User
Autore

@Claudio @KolAsim
Ho rigirato tutto sul forum indicatomi da Claudio . Effettivamente la vostra soluzione era allettante 
ma non funziona con le animazioni , ho provato ad esportare in gif visto che il lazy loading viaggia bene con le immagini ... pultroppo il problema è che una gif viene eseguita all ' infinito , nel mio caso l'animazione deve essere eseguita una sola volta
Saluti 
Rino

Leggi di più
Postato il da Rino D.
Claudio D.
Claudio D.
Moderator
Utente del mese IT
Rino D.
 pultroppo il problema è che una gif viene eseguita all ' infinito , nel mio caso l'animazione deve essere eseguita una sola volta

Sei sicuro ?

è un po' che non faccio animazioni con le Gif , ma mi ricordo che si poteva impostare se eseguire l'animazione una volta solo o all'infinito...

Leggi di più
Postato il da Claudio D.
Rino D.
Rino D.
User
Autore

Ho utilizzato microsoft gif animator per modificare il fattore di loop ad 1 che conbinato con l'effetto lazy loading fà il suo porco effetto :) .... e mi và bene!!! e vi ringrazio per il suggerimento ...
naturalmente scrollando la pagina e ritornando al livello "visuale" della mia gif questa non viene più rieseguita..
.... sarebbe utile implementare un effetto di questo tipo in website
Saluti e ringraziamenti dovuti ....
Rino 

Leggi di più
Postato il da Rino D.
Rino D.
Rino D.
User
Autore

@Claudio 
Si hai perfettamente ragione , infatti mi sono dovuto appoggiare ad un prodotto di terze parti 
poichè in webanimator non è prevista la possibilità di gestire il numero di cicli
;)
Grazie Claudio

Leggi di più
Postato il da Rino D.
Claudio D.
Claudio D.
Moderator
Utente del mese IT

Se ok, chiudi con corretto.

Leggi di più
Postato il da Claudio D.